STEP 1-Telecom signs deal with CISL, UIL and UGL to avoid layoffs-Mise – Reuters Italy

(Adds union)

ROME, September 7 (Reuters) – The Ministry of Development, Telecom Italy has reached an agreement with the unions CISL, UIL and UGL (exclude the CGIL) to avoid layoffs and manage redundancies with solidarity contracts.

‘As it said in a ministry statement.

“No worker Telecom Italy will be fired. The redundancies will be managed with solidarity. The objective has been achieved with the framework agreement signed today at the Ministry of Development, “the statement said.

According to Stefano Conti, general secretary UGL Telephone, redundancies will be around 3,000 and for 300 you will comparison with voluntary redundancy, the others will be dealt with solidarity contracts.

“The agreement reflects significantly the demands made in previous meetings by the unions and by the same ministry. The comparison continues now in the company headquarters to give practical implementation to the instructions contained in the cartel “, adds the ministry statement.
